#9f1455 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f1455 is composed of 62.4% red, 7.8%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.4%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 331.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.7% and a lightness of 35.1%. #9f1455 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ff28aa with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#9f1455 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9f1455 has RGB values of R:159, G:20,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.47,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10425429.

Shades and Tints of #9f1455
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fdf0f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9f1455
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5959 is the less saturated color, while #ad0654 is the most saturated one.
